Ghost Pivots

Ghost

Member
Platform
  1. Thinkorswim
Ghost Pivots, derived from fib numbers, enjoy.



Code:
#Ghost Fib Pivots
#Discord User : Omar1981#5487
#9/15/2021

input aggregation = AggregationPeriod.DAY;
def high = high(period = aggregation)[1];
def low = low(period = aggregation)[1];

def range = high - low;

plot f1   = low + range * .5;
f1.SetPaintingStrategy(PaintingStrategy.horizontAL);
f1.SetDefaultColor(color.black);
f1.setLineWeight(2);
plot f2   = low + range * .382;
f2.SetPaintingStrategy(PaintingStrategy.horizontAL);
f2.SetDefaultColor(color.black);
f2.setLineWeight(2);
plot f3   = low + range * .832;
f3.SetPaintingStrategy(PaintingStrategy.horizontAL);
f3.SetDefaultColor(color.black);
f3.setLineWeight(2);
plot f4   = low + range * .941;
f4.SetPaintingStrategy(PaintingStrategy.horizontAL);
f4.SetDefaultColor(color.black);
f4.setLineWeight(2);
plot f5   = low + range * 1.264;
f5.SetPaintingStrategy(PaintingStrategy.horizontAL);
f5.SetDefaultColor(color.black);
f5.setLineWeight(2);
plot f6   = low + range * 1.382;
f6.SetPaintingStrategy(PaintingStrategy.horizontAL);
f6.SetDefaultColor(color.black);
f6.setLineWeight(2);
plot f7   = low + range * 1.823;
f7.SetPaintingStrategy(PaintingStrategy.horizontAL);
f7.SetDefaultColor(color.black);
f7.setLineWeight(2);
plot f8   = low + range * 1.941;
f8.SetPaintingStrategy(PaintingStrategy.horizontAL);
f8.SetDefaultColor(color.black);
f8.setLineWeight(2);
plot f9   = low + range * 2.264;
f9.SetPaintingStrategy(PaintingStrategy.horizontAL);
f9.SetDefaultColor(color.black);
f9.setLineWeight(2);
plot f10   = low + range * 2.382;
f10.SetPaintingStrategy(PaintingStrategy.horizontAL);
f10.SetDefaultColor(color.black);
f10.setLineWeight(2);



plot f11   = low + range * -.059;
f11.SetPaintingStrategy(PaintingStrategy.horizontAL);
f11.SetDefaultColor(color.black);
f11.setLineWeight(2);
plot f12   = low + range * -.177;
f12.SetPaintingStrategy(PaintingStrategy.horizontAL);
f12.SetDefaultColor(color.black);
f12.setLineWeight(2);
plot f13   = low + range * -.5;
f13.SetPaintingStrategy(PaintingStrategy.horizontAL);
f13.SetDefaultColor(color.black);
f13.setLineWeight(2);
plot f14   = low + range * -.618;
f14.SetPaintingStrategy(PaintingStrategy.horizontAL);
f14.SetDefaultColor(color.black);
f14.setLineWeight(2);
plot f15   = low + range * -.941;
f15.SetPaintingStrategy(PaintingStrategy.horizontAL);
f15.SetDefaultColor(color.black);
f15.setLineWeight(2);
plot f16   = low + range * -1.059;
f16.SetPaintingStrategy(PaintingStrategy.horizontAL);
f16.SetDefaultColor(color.black);
f16.setLineWeight(2);
plot f17   = low + range * -1.382;
f17.SetPaintingStrategy(PaintingStrategy.horizontAL);
f17.SetDefaultColor(color.black);
f17.setLineWeight(2);
plot f18   = low + range * -1.5;
f18.SetPaintingStrategy(PaintingStrategy.horizontAL);
f18.SetDefaultColor(color.black);
f18.setLineWeight(2);
 
Top